Voltas 1.5 Ton 5 Star AC Price and Typical Cost Ranges 2026

Buyers typically pay between about $1,200 and $3,700 for a Voltas 1.5 ton 5 star split air conditioner, with the final price driven by unit model, installation complexity, and local labor. This Voltas AC price summary shows low-average-high totals and common per-unit and installation fees so U.S. shoppers can plan a realistic budget.

What A Voltas 1.5 Ton 5 Star AC Typically Costs to Buy and Install

Expect a total quoted price of $1,200-$3,700 for a Voltas 1.5 ton 5-star split AC installed in a typical single-room scenario.

Typical unit-only prices run $600-$2,000 depending on model, warranty, and importer/distributor markups. Installation and parts commonly add $450-$1,700. Assumptions: single-zone split, 1.5 ton capacity, 110–220 ft² cooling target, U.S. retail channels.

Site Variables That Most Affect a Voltas 1.5 Ton Quote

Access, line-set length, and required electrical upgrades are the top variables that shift a quote.

Examples with numeric thresholds: adding over 25 linear feet of copper line set typically adds $150-$400; requiring a new 240V circuit or panel work usually adds $400-$1,200; constrained access needing a lift or scaffold often adds $200-$600.

Ways To Reduce the Price on a Voltas 1.5 Ton 5 Star System

Buy the unit during off-peak seasons, keep existing line set if compatible, and get multiple on-site quotes to reduce cost.

Specific tactics: schedule installation in spring/fall to avoid peak summer premiums, reuse an existing outdoor pad and line set if under 25 ft and leak-free, accept manufacturer-standard warranty instead of extended plans, and compare at least three local quotes.

Typical Installation Time, Crew Size, and Labor Rates

Most installs take 4–8 hours with a 2-person crew; expect labor rates of $75-$125 per hour.

Simple swap-outs with existing wiring: 4–6 hours. New line set or electrical work: 6–12 hours. Assumptions: single-zone split, normal attic/closet access, no major drywall or mechanical changes.

Typical Add-Ons, Fees, and Permit Considerations That Change Price

Expect small mandatory fees (permit, disposal) and optional add-ons (Wi‑Fi module, advanced filters) to increment the quote by $25-$800.

Common extras: smart controllers $50-$200, upgraded filtration $80-$300, surge protection or electrical upgrades $200-$1,000, HVAC permit $0-$200 depending on jurisdiction.
